NZD/USD bulls back at the table on impressive NZ jobs
NZD/USD keeps with the bid and has rallied on the 0.73 handle to score 0.7323 highs so far after impressive jobs data.
NZ Q2 employment change came in at a whopping 2.4% q/q vs 0.6% expected with a drop of 0.2% in the unemployment number and a higher participation rate of 69.7% vs 68.8%. this coupled with New Zealand GDT price index at 12.7% vs 6.6% prior, the bird is attracting good demand in a weaker DXY environment on dovish Fed expectations for the year.
